Suggest Treatment For Skin Rashes On The Buttock And Armpit
I have a rash on my bottom, lower back and under arms for over a week. I don t ever remember having such before. What causes it? Is it dry skin reaction during the winter? What can be done to relieve the itchy feeling and correct the problem? Thank you! Gary
Dear Gary It seems that you probably are allergic to some new dress that you have worn especially if you sweat a lot in the mentioned areas.The dry skin during winters is more likely to affect your lower legs, back, arms, and whole of the back and would respond to use of moisturize or oily preparation. You would be able to explain yourself better if you send the picture of areas involved or get yourself checked up.In the meantime, use only cotton dresses and the ones that are quite loose while refraining from the deodorants or harsh soaps. For itching, I would suggest that anti allergic medication may be taken.
